Excerpt from The Technique of Dream Interpretation

We ask the dreamer, what occurs to him in connection with the dream. If he is a novice, he will invariably reply: Nothing at all. What should occur to me? We then insist that the dream must suggest occurrences. If the resistance or the lack of understanding is considerable, the dreamer will still insist that nothing occurs to him.

Now there are various aids, nevertheless, to get him to talk. We ask him of what actual experience the dream reminds him. About this most people have some idea. They regard the dream as the distorted reproduction of various experiences and are quite willing to offer these. Then one observes that the presentation of the dream has altered or falsified the experience, that strange elements have insinuated themselves - and thus come unawares into the anal ysis. Or one asks, what meaning for the life of the dreamer this or that person occurring in the dream has, and thus brings the dreamer to speech. As a rule he then speaks on and reveals his suppressed material.
